Turkey Startup Ecosystem in Q1 2021 - Key Highlights
• Q1 ‘21 was a record-breaking period for Turkey as total VC funding in this quarter alone surpassed funding raised in 2020 by 68%. Turkey amassed the largest VC funding by far across all EVM countries.
• The number of deals in Q1 ‘21 rose by 81% when compared to Q1 ‘20.
• In terms of capital allocation, the top 5 deals alone represented 84% of all funding deployed in Q1 ‘21.
• Every fifth dollar invested in Turkish startups went into the Gaming industry. Four of the top 10 deals in this quarter were made into Gaming.
• Delivery & Logistics topped the ranking by the amount invested, with almost all of it raised by Getir.

*This report aggregates and analyses tech startup investments in 19 countries in the Emerging Venture Markets. EVM includes Turkey, Pakistan, and 17 countries in the Middle East and North Africa - listed alphabetically: Algeria, Bahrain, Egypt, Iraq, Jordan, Kuwait, Lebanon, Libya, Morocco, Oman, Palestine, Qatar, Saudi Arabia (KSA), Syria, Tunisia, United Arab Emirates (UAE), and Yemen.
